Moses Abukari has over 17 years of experience in agricultural development, currently serving as a Programme Manager at the International Fund for Agricultural Development since July 2006. Within this organization, Moses has held various roles, including Country Programme Manager, Country Portfolio Expert and Youth Focal Point, and Irrigation and Water Management Expert. In addition to professional work in agriculture, Moses has been a team player for the VCN Basketball team in Rome since 2006. Academic credentials include a BSc in Agriculture from Wageningen University & Research (2003-2006) and a Secondary School Certificate with a major in General Agricultural Science from Bishop Herman College (1994-1996).
